Home care companies often sell more than one thing, and that changes the page plan. Companion care, personal care, dementia support, respite care, live-in care, and veteran-focused services may each need their own messaging, query mapping, and location coverage.
AtOnce can organize the work around your highest-value service lines first. That may mean building or rewriting the pages most likely to support intake, while keeping ad copy, page copy, and form language consistent.
For many care providers, lead generation is local before it is anything else. AtOnce can plan around city pages, nearby market pages, and service-area terms that reflect how families search when they need care at home.
This does not mean publishing thin location pages at scale. It means deciding which markets deserve dedicated landing pages, which should be supported by core service pages, and where paid search may make more sense than waiting on organic traction.

Before scaling traffic, AtOnce can review how a visitor becomes a lead today. That can include service page structure, headline clarity, local relevance, form length, phone visibility, trust cues, and the pages paid campaigns point to.
The goal in this phase is simple: reduce obvious friction before adding more traffic. For many teams, this step can help prevent waste and make later SEO or PPC work easier to justify internally.
